I think I would injure myself with that butthook. That is probably a very sweet rifle to shoot. CO2 was only around for a few years until PCP rifles became the thing. For someone that doesn't already have a PCP air rifle, CO2 would make a very cost effective alternative provided you have a local source for bulk CO2.
